Responsibilities
- Design highly scalable, mission-critical brokerage systems for the Japan market.
- Develop middle- and back-office systems, gRPC microservices, REST and gRPC APIs, and third-party vendor integrations.
- Enhance the core framework to support multiple languages, currencies, markets, and Japan-specific requirements including NISA, MyNumber, withholding tax, and JP-GAAP accounting.
- Translate requirements from Japanese regulators, vendors, partners, and business stakeholders into technical specifications for global engineering teams.
- Collaborate with regional technical leads and cross-functional teams across time zones.
- Troubleshoot incidents and bugs, participate in on-call rotations, and support production issues during Japan business hours.
- Mentor teammates, contribute to engineering practices, support regional recruitment initiatives, and foster Alpaca culture in Japan.
- Participate in goal setting and architect autonomous solutions aligned with strategic objectives.
Requirements
- Native or JLPT N1-level Japanese fluency and business-level English fluency are required.
- Proven experience designing and developing complex financial systems, preferably with double-entry accounting, ledger structures, and transaction reconciliation.
- Experience building scalable, highly available financial applications handling multi-currency transactions.
- Familiarity with financial-market regulatory compliance, preferably including Japanese frameworks such as FIEA, FSA, JSDA, or JIPF.
- Proficiency in at least one statically typed language such as Go, Rust, Java, Kotlin, C#, Scala, or C++.
- Experience with financial APIs, market-data integrations, and trade-settlement processes.
- Strong computer science fundamentals, software architecture experience, communication skills, and problem-solving ability.
- Experience with domain-driven design and event-driven design.
- Ability to work independently in a fully remote global team and lead or troubleshoot incidents during Japan business hours.
- Experience in the Japanese financial services sector and with JPX, JSCC, JASDEC, Japanese banks, NISA, iDeCo, tokutei-koza, or MyNumber is preferred.
- Go proficiency, startup experience, vendor management, organizational budgeting, and experience with global English-speaking teams are preferred.

About Alpaca
Alpaca is a US-headquartered, self-clearing broker-dealer and a global leader in brokerage infrastructure APIs providing access to stocks, ETFs, options, fixed income, and crypto. Alpaca delivers embeddable finance solutions for tokenization, fully paid securities lending, high-yield cash, 24/5 trading, Shariah-compliant investing, and more. Today, Alpaca powers over 9 million brokerage accounts across hundreds of fintechs and institutions in 40+ countries, with over $320M in funding from top investors including Drive Capital, Portage Ventures, Spark Capital, Tribe Capital, Social Leverage, Derayah Financial, Horizons Ventures, Unbound, SBI Group, Elefund, and Y Combinator.
